Is arranged marriage free love?
1 answer
2026-06-26 22:17
Arranged marriage was not free love. In the creation of novels, these were two completely different concepts of love and marriage, which were often used to construct conflicts in stories and relationships between characters. Take " The Wind Chaser " as an example. The relationship between the characters reflected the difference between arranged marriage and free love. Shen Tunan and Su Cishu were initially arranged by their families. This arranged marriage was based on family interests, matching social status, and other factors. They accepted this arrangement when they were young. Later on, the Su family had an accident and the engagement was torn apart. Su Cishu worked hard alone. After Shen Tunan returned from his studies, he still had feelings for Su Cishu. At this time, their relationship gradually developed into a free love model after experiencing all kinds of things, and finally led a happy life. This showed that there was a difference between an arranged marriage and a free love. One was a family-led marriage, while the other was an individual's choice based on feelings. There were similar scenes in other novels. For example, in some novels, an arranged marriage might cause the protagonist to fall into a helpless situation, while free love was the ideal way for the protagonist to pursue happiness. What are the characteristics of an arranged love novel?
1 answer
2024-11-26 04:47
Well, arranged love novels typically have a complex web of family dynamics. The families play a huge role in bringing the two main characters together. There are often external pressures like social status and family reputation that influence the relationship. The journey of the characters from strangers to lovers within the framework of an arrangement is what makes these novels interesting.
What are the challenges in arranged marriage love stories?
2 answers
2024-11-16 04:16
The first challenge is often the pressure from families. Sometimes, families have high expectations which can put stress on the couple in an arranged marriage. Also, there may be differences in cultural backgrounds even within the same community. However, as they spend time together, they can learn to accept and love each other's uniqueness. For instance, if one is from a more traditional family and the other is more modern, they need to find a middle ground. This process can be difficult but also rewarding in the end.
